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3465865246 6836751868 822041228 20 53666742
14420127919 44728 995021797
14420127919 44728 995021797
75618352 09 70180 92
All about undefined
Interested in learning more?
14420127919 44728 995021797
75618352 09 70180 92
See more
8283705702 48 933449931
9949 7983 7705767500
See more
750 87483706817 22159005156
35362984436 453 5269 040501
See more